A Heart Attack Unites Divorced Couple

A couple, who had divorced in 2018, came back together after five years of separation, but not before the man suffered a heart attack in August this year.

The couple, Vinay Jaiswal and Pooja Chaudhary, from Ghaziabad’s Kaushambi had divorced in 2018, ending their six-year-old marriage.

Insiders said there were differences cropping up between the two within a year of their marriage. As things escalated, they finally decided to file for a divorce.

Their divorce case went through three courts – the family court in Ghaziabad, a high court and finally the Supreme Court. After a long drawn-out legal battle which lasted five years, Vinay and Pooja finally separated in 2018.

In August this year, Vinay suffered a heart attack and had to undergo an open heart surgery. When the news of his surgery reached Pooja, she became anxious to know the well-being of her ex-husband and went straight to the hospital to meet him.

As the two spent time together, the love between them rekindled and they decided to put aside their differences to marry again.

On November 23, Vinay and Pooja got married again in the presence of each other’s family. The wedding ceremony was held in an Arya Samaj temple in Ghaziabad’s Kavi Nagar.

Vinay Jaiswal works as an assistant general manager at Steel Authority of India Limited (SAIL) while Pooja Chaudhary, originally a resident of Patna, used to work as a teacher.
